How to Choose the Right Marriage Counsellor for Your Relationship

Marriage is a beautiful journey, but it comes with its challenges. Even the strongest couples face conflicts, communication breakdowns, or moments of emotional distance. Seeking guidance from a professional marriage counsellor can help you navigate these challenges and strengthen your bond. Choosing the right counsellor is crucial for a successful and transformative experience. Here’s how to make the best choice for your relationship.

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a Marriage Counsellor

Finding the best marriage counsellor is more than just selecting someone with a license. It’s about finding a professional who understands your relationship, can communicate effectively, and helps both partners feel heard and supported. Consider the following factors when making your choice:

1. Identify Your Needs as a Couple

Before beginning counselling, it’s essential to clarify your goals together. Understanding your specific needs ensures that the therapist you choose can provide targeted support for your relationship.

  • Clarify the goals you want to achieve in counselling.
  • Decide whether you need short-term guidance or long-term support.
  • Determine whether you prefer in-person sessions, online therapy, or a hybrid approach.

2. Look for Experience in Relationship Dynamics

A counsellor with experience in relationship dynamics understands the complexities of couples’ interactions and challenges. Working with someone who has dealt with similar issues increases the effectiveness of therapy.

  • Choose a counsellor with proven experience working with couples.
  • Ask if they have experience addressing communication issues, conflict resolution, or infidelity.
  • Ensure they can balance both partners’ needs while fostering understanding.

3. Ask About Their Approach and Style

Each counsellor has a unique style. Some are directive and interactive, guiding couples through exercises, while others focus on reflective conversations. Choosing someone whose style matches your comfort level helps make sessions productive.

  • Ask how they structure sessions.
  • Determine if they use a direct and interactive approach.
  • Confirm they are comfortable mediating difficult conversations between partners.

4. Consider Compatibility and Comfort

Even the most skilled counsellor will not be effective if you don’t feel comfortable with them. A strong therapeutic relationship is built on trust, openness, and mutual respect.

  • Assess whether both partners feel heard and valued during consultations.
  • Ensure the environment feels safe, supportive, and non-judgmental.
  • Compatibility helps ensure engagement and openness during sessions.

5. Verify Credentials and Professionalism

Credentials reflect the counsellor’s training, expertise, and adherence to ethical standards. Ensuring professionalism safeguards your experience and provides peace of mind.

6. Start With an Initial Consultation

Many counsellors offer a brief initial consultation. This is a great way to evaluate if they are a good fit for you and your partner before committing to regular sessions.

  • Discuss your goals as a couple.
  • Learn about the counsellor’s approach and techniques.
  • Ask about session frequency, duration, and fees.

What to Look for in a Good Counsellor

Choosing the right marriage counsellor is about more than qualifications; it’s about finding someone who is the right fit for you and your partner. A good counsellor creates a safe, supportive space and helps both partners feel understood and valued.

  • Both partners feel heard and respected during sessions.
  • The counsellor demonstrates empathy, patience, and professionalism.
  • They have experience with issues similar to yours.
  • They are transparent about their approach, session structure, and fees.
  • Sessions foster a safe, non-judgmental environment for honest communication.
